dc.description.abstract | The pressure gradient developed across the diameter of a 1 tube formed into a centrifugal flow-loop 10 in diameter was not sensitive to changes in the consistency of paper pulp up to 1gm per 100ml of suspension. Thus such a device can serve as a columetric flow rate sensor of dilute suspensions. The pressure gradient across a straight section of 2/3 PVC pipe was found to decrease as the pulp content increased. A relation vetween pressure gradient and consistency was developed from which concentrations of high bright bleach pulp suspensions in the range from 0.5 to 1.1gm per 100ml can ve predicted within about 10%. The possibility of controlling cosistency with this method of detection is suggested. | - |
